No prob, thats what we're here for

As for the trim, did you get all of the front dash pieces? The door panels are a piece of cake, but I had a bloody hell of a time getting the dash pieces out when I did my heater; they didn't need to come off, obviously, for the heater job, but like you and many others, the wood grain was not high in my favor of things to look at so while I had the interior pulled apart anyway, I yanked the trim and heeded the advice of the ever creative and knowledgeable ImTheDevil and wrapped all the trim in suede and couldn't be more pleased with the result

As for the dash removal itself, I did my work at my buddy's garage at a dealership he works at so he had access to all the stuff to drain and recharge the refrigerant so that worked out well in my favor, but I probably still wouldn't have a working heater had I not had that resource to save me having to pay someone else to drain and fill it for the job.
